About Braemor Court
Braemor Court is a detached house in Bristol (BS9 3HX). It has a recorded floor area of 61 m² (around 657 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(September 2017) shows an E (score 51),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. When first surveyed in October 2016 the rating was F,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Poor to Very Good, window ef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 78),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ity. At 61 m² this is the 5th smallest of 6 units on EPC record in Braemor Court, where floor areas span 58–61 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to D, with this unit at the bottom.
Today's modelled estimate of £243,000 is 18.5% above the 2017 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£312/sq ft) was about 26.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ode. On the market in February 2017 and unlisted since — roughly 9 years.
